Barn Painting Service in Waco, TX

Barn painting services involve applying protective and decorative coatings to barn exteriors, including siding, wood panels, and metal surfaces. These projects typically cover repainting or staining existing barns, as well as initial coats for new structures.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ance the appearance of their property, protect the barn from weather damage, and extend the lifespan of the building materials. Before requesting barn painting, property owners should consider factors such as the current condition of the surface, the type of paint or stain suitable for their climate, and any necessary preparation work like cleaning or repairs to ensure a smooth, durable finish.

Understanding the scope of barn painting projects is important for property owners to make informed decisions. Common inquiries include the best type of coating for specific materials, how to address peeling or rotting wood, and whether any surface treatments are needed prior to painting. It’s also helpful to know about the longevity of different finishes and any maintenance requirements afterward.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project meets expectations and provides long-lasting protection and visual appeal for the barn.

FAQ

Barn Painting Service Questions

What types of barn surfaces can be painted? Barn painting services typically cover wood, metal, and other exterior surfaces to enhance appearance and protection.

Are special preparations needed before painting a barn? Surface cleaning, sanding, and minor repairs are usually recommended to ensure proper paint adhesion and durability.

What finishes are available for barn painting? Various finishes, including matte, satin, and semi-gloss, can be applied based on the desired look and function.

How often should a barn be repainted? Repainting frequency depends on the material and exposure, but generally every 5 to 10 years is typical for maintaining condition.
